Texas has strict gambling laws, making sports betting illegal in the state as of 2025. Tennis fans in Texas may need to travel to other states where sports betting is legal or use offshore platforms to place bets. However, using offshore platforms comes with risks, including potential taxation on winnings and lack of consumer protections.
Tennis enthusiasts in Texas considering sports betting should be aware of legal risks, lack of consumer protections, tax implications, and the importance of responsible gambling. Efforts to legalize sports betting in Texas have gained momentum, but opposition from lawmakers and advocacy groups has slowed progress.
